Neiman Group Featured in Harrisburg Magazine as Top Four Coolest Office Spaces
NEIMAN GROUP, HARRISBURG, 12,000 SQUARE FEET
Advertising agencies are notorious for pushing the envelope in office design and certainly Neiman Group is no exception. Housed in the historical Old Waterworks Building with the Susquehanna River as a backdrop, Neiman Group, a premier award-winning full service ad agency, has one of the most distinct office spaces in the city. The mix of the old, the new and the quirky makes the building a fun place to visit and a goldmine of creative inspiration for the employees. "We have unique offices and they work for an ad agency," says Frank Coleman, Neiman's Chief Operating Officer, "but they would be a little avant garde for another business." True. What other company could get away with twisty stone caverns, a room filled with giant rusty filters (from the waterworks days), a mock apartment with graffitied walls, a pool table, a punching bag, a twin bed, and a drum set? And let's not forget the little white dog in the bandana. His name is Barkley. If it sounds like mayhem, it's not; every detail is carefully planned and positioned throughout the agency with one space transitioning into the next. It's a smorgasbord for the senses, but never overwhelming. "Every wall color and piece of furniture was concepted together," says Steven Neiman, President and CEO. "Every wall covering, every fabric was to enhance the building. There are so many different rooms, all unique spaces, but it still works." Neiman admits to being downright anal about the details, not just for the sake of style, but also function. The office chairs are airplane manufactured for comfort. There is an employee washer and dryer to allow for mutli-tasking home and work responsibilities. And green touches (like the wall made of crushed sunflower seed shells) to embrace environmental responsibility. The decor has been carefully crafted to attract the creative, off-beat and daring individuals who work at Neiman. "When recruits come here they see the attitude of our agency," says Neiman. And referring to the cost for constructing such and elaborate office space, he says "It's been worth it in so many ways."
